Shopping around can make sense and the production crew advocate it themselves if it genuinely saves money.

I'm housebound and reliant on deliveries at the moment which means it's easier to buy from one supermarket BUT when I'm not housebound I shop in different shops for different items and it does save me money. I occasionally shop from a different place if there's something specific I want I can't get from usual place.

But I know (keep a memo on my phone) the prices in each shop so I KNOW if it's really cheaper or not.

Eg

Frozen - Iceland are generally cheaper and have more choice

Greengrocers for fruit and veg - supermarkets undercut them initially but certainly for in season basics they're often cheaper and better quality

Aldi/lidl for basics available everywhere - dried pasta, tinned veg, some chilled products

"Ordinary" supermarket for whatever I can't get elsewhere or which is actually cheaper at that store at that time and I varied depending on offers at that time (I've noticed on branded products the offers tend to rotate around the big supermarkets, eg if marmite is on offer in Tesco and the offer period ends it's then usually started being on offer in ASDA or Morrisons) it's easy enough to check on this either through their own websites or there are apps you can check on.

Pound/bargain shops like b&m snd home bargains - for branded products they tend to be cheaper though you have to be careful they're not smaller package sizes, eg Heinz beans might SEEM cheap but the tin is 2/3 normal size. Certainly usually cheaper for non food items like fairy liquid, disinfectants etc

"Chemists" for toiletries and beauty products and sometimes "oddities" like air freshener tends to be cheaper in these places.
